> Sorry to jump to hijack the thread  like that , however i would like
> to just to inform you  that we recently achieve a milestone out of the
> research project I'm leading. We enhanced KVM in order to deliver
> post copy live migration using RDMA at kernel level.
> 
> Few point on the architecture of the system :
> 
> * RDMA communication engine in kernel ( you can use soft iwarp or soft
> ROCE if you don't have hardware acceleration, however we also support
> standard RDMA enabled NIC) .

Do you mean infiniband subsystem?


> * Naturally Page are transferred with Zerop copy protocol
> * Leverage the async page fault system.
> * Pre paging / faulting
> * No context switch as everything is handled within kernel and using
> the page fault system.
> * Hybrid migration ( pre + post copy) available

Ah, I've been also planing this.
After pre-copy phase, is the dirty bitmap sent?

So far I've thought naively that pre-copy phase would be finished by the
number of iterations. On the other hand your choice is timeout of
pre-copy phase. Do you have rationale? or it was just natural for you?


> * Rely on an independent Kernel Module
> * No modification to the KVM kernel Module
> * Minimal Modification to the Qemu-Kvm code
> * We plan to add the page prioritization algo in order to optimise the
> pre paging algo and background transfer

Where do you plan to implement? in qemu or in your kernel module?
This algo could be shared.

thanks in advance.

> > On 01/04/2012 05:03 AM, Isaku Yamahata wrote:
> >> Yes, it's quite doable in user space(qemu) with a kernel-enhancement.
> >> And it would be easy to convert a separated daemon process into a thread
> >> in qemu.
> >>
> >> I think it should be done out side of qemu process for some reasons.
> >> (I just repeat same discussion at the KVM-forum because no one remembers
> >> it)
> >>
> >> - ptrace (and its variant)
> >> ?? Some people want to investigate guest ram on host (qemu stopped or 
> >> lively).
> >> ?? For example, enhance crash utility and it will attach qemu process and
> >> ?? debug guest kernel.
> >
> > To debug the guest kernel you don't need to stop qemu itself. ?? I agree
> > it's a problem for qemu debugging though.
> >
> >>
> >> - core dump
> >> ?? qemu process may core-dump.
> >> ?? As postmortem analysis, people want to investigate guest RAM.
> >> ?? Again enhance crash utility and it will read the core file and analyze
> >> ?? guest kernel.
> >> ?? When creating core, the qemu process is already dead.
> >
> > Yes, strong point.
> >
> >> It precludes the above possibilities to handle fault in qemu process.
> >
> > I agree.
